MOROCCAN MINT TEA RECIPE - FOOD.COM



Moroccan Mint Tea Recipe - Food.com image

Mint tea isn't just a drink in Morocco. It is a sign of hospitality and friendship and tradition. Because this drink is so popular, it is served all day long, after every meal and with every conversation. Moroccans take great pride in their tea and will often ask a visitor who among their group of friends makes the best cup of mint tea.

Total Time 15 minutes

Prep Time 10 minutes

Cook Time 5 minutes

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 4

10 sprigs of fresh mint, plus extra for garnish
3 teaspoons green tea
3 tablespoons sugar (or more to taste)
4 cups water

Steps:

  • Boil the water and pour a small amount in the teapot, swishing it around to warm the pot.
  • Combine the mint and green tea and sugar in the teapot, then fill it with the rest of the hot water.
  • Let the tea brew for three minutes.
  • Set out glasses for the tea.
  • A shot-glass is close to the slender glasses used in Morocco.
  • Fill just one glass with the tea, then pour it back in the pot.
  • Repeat.
  • This helps to dissolve and distribute the sugar.
  • Pour the tea.
  • You want a nice foam on the tea so always pour with the teapot a high distance above the glasses.
  • If you do not have at least a little foam on the top of the first glass, then pour it back into the teapot and try again until the tea starts to foam up nicely.
  • Garnish with the remaining sprigs of mint.

MEDITERRANEAN ICED TEA RECIPE - FOOD.COM



Mediterranean Iced Tea Recipe - Food.com image

Make and share this Mediterranean Iced Tea recipe from Food.com.

Total Time 5 minutes

Prep Time 5 minutes

Yield 1 cocktail, 1 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 ounce orange liqueur
1 ounce amaro liqueur, Averna is the recommendation
1 ounce fresh lime juice
1 ounce fresh orange juice
1 ounce simple syrup
splash soda water

Steps:

  • Shake the orange liqueur, amaro, lime juice, orange juice, simple syrup and soda with ice in a cocktail shaker.
  • Strain over ice into a highball glass.

MEDITERRANEAN HERB MIX RECIPE | EATINGWELL
In the Mediterranean region, blends of dried locally grown herbs are common. This version is ideal for vegetables, seafood, poultry, and pork.
From eatingwell.com
Total Time 5 minutes
Category Healthy Sage Recipes
Calories 7 calories per serving
  • Combine oregano, rosemary, thyme, mint, and sage in a clean glass jar with a tight-fitting lid. Secure the lid and shake until the seasonings are mixed well. Store in a cool, dry place (or the fridge) for up to 6 months. Just before using, crush the herbs between your fingers, with a mortar and pestle, or in a spice mill to release their flavors.

IKARIA’S FAMOUS DRINKING HERBS: 6 TEAS AND NATURAL ...
Jan 17, 2022 · 2. Mint . Ikaria has 3 common types of mint tea. First, there’s spearmint, which is best known and mainly used in cooking; however, as a tea, it also serves as an antidote to upset stomachs. Then there’s peppermint, which is perfect for calming stomach cramps, menstrual pains, fevers, and colds.

WHAT IS GREEK MOUNTAIN TEA? (AND WHY IS IT GOOD FOR YOU ...
Feb 09, 2021 · Mountain tea is a naturally caffeine-free herbal tea made from a single variety of the sideritis plant. Also known as "Shepherd's Tea" or "Greek Mountain Tea," it is referred to in Greece as Tsai tou vounou, translating directly to "Tea of the mountain." It is brewed using the dried flowers, leaves, and stems of the sideritis plant, found in ...
